自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(5)
  • 收藏
  • 关注

原创 jzoj5408 【NOIP2017提高A组集训10.21】Dark (巧设状态的DP)

题面LichKing 希望收集邪恶的黑暗力量,并依靠它称霸世界。 世间的黑暗力量被描述成一个长度为N 的非负整数序列{Ai},每次它可以选择这个序列中的两个相邻的正整数,让他们的值同时减一并获得一点邪恶力量,直到不存在满足条件的数。 然而你不希望他能够得逞,所以你会使得他收集的能量尽可能少。 分析发现当前状态可以划分为f[i][j][0/1]表示当前剩余j个,上个是否用完,这

2017-10-21 15:44:41 405

原创 jzoj5402 【NOIP2017提高A组模拟10.8】God Knows

分析考虑一个简单的dp,设f[i]表示现在1..i的连线全部被删除,最后一个选的是i的代价。转移有些特别,从j=[1,i)中选出一条不与i-p[i]相交的并且(i,j)中没有不与这两条相交的,就可以f[i]=f[j]+c[i]. 想一想答案是什么? 使得(i,n]中所有连线都与i-p[i]相交,则此f[i]可以作为答案。 也就是(i,n]中所有p[j]小于p[i]的这个dp是O(n^2)的,我

2017-10-20 19:43:16 596

原创 jzoj5399 【NOIP2017提高A组模拟10.7】Confess

题意给定n+1(n<=6e3且n为偶数)个大小为n的集合,集合里的数都在[1,2n]内。 请求出任意一对交集大小大于n/2的集合。分析毛都没看出来,所以就打了50分的bitset. 我们考虑一下他交集大小的期望,也就是任意两对交集大小的平均数。 设有元素i的集合有ci个,任意一对ci都有1的贡献。 E=∑C(ci,2)C(n+1,2)E=\sum\frac{C(ci,2)}{C(n+1,2)

2017-10-07 16:03:31 373

原创 拉格朗日插值法(求自然数幂和)

背景求∑ni=1ik\sum_{i=1}^{n} i^k,给定n分析设g(x)=∑xi=1ikg(x)=\sum_{i=1}^{x} i^k。考虑k=1与k=2时的公式,不难得出每个g(x)实际上都是一个k+1次多项式。(这是猜想,具体证明看http://blog.csdn.net/jokerwyt/article/details/54141757,那个递推式就是k+1次的)那

2017-10-06 16:10:11 2125

原创 jzoj5394 【NOIP2017提高A组模拟10.5】Ping

题面 分析很容易看出模型:有若干条路径,选最少的点使得每条路径上都有点。并给出方案。 考虑一条链,其实就抽象成数轴上的线段。显然是贪心。(然而我最后五分钟才想起来!?把线段按右端点从小到大排序,考虑右端点最左的一条线段,其他线段要么与他没有交集,要么从右边有交。那么这条线段取点一定是取右端点能覆盖更多的线段。 把覆盖掉的线段删除,重复上述步骤,直到覆盖完毕。 还能得出一个结论: 只选右端点。

2017-10-05 20:26:42 454

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除